    Replacement thermostat
    General Controls T-80 thermostat is not working. Is there a replacement I can use ?
  • Aug 22, 2008, 03:40 PM
    hvac1000
    Is it a low voltage style thermostat?
    Does it control both heat and air?
    How many wires feeds the thermostat?
    Type of equipment it is used on?

    It can probably be replaced but since I have no listing on that model number it has to very old. That is the reason for the questions above.
  • Aug 26, 2008, 01:52 PM
    junv
    It's a two wires feeds low voltage style home thermostat (24VAC) that controls only heat. Thanks...
  • Aug 26, 2008, 02:58 PM
    hvac1000
    A Honeywell T-87 or other 24 volt heat only thermostat should work.
